Output 254b68b0b305c37c0e77f7d78c03cdafed3a4947f74bfa5995c36f0739e92eab:8

value
2090000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bba434d0b91740b170cd8a803f1cc371974bfef OP_EQUAL
address
3BWdMqp4o8GBKwvZzYxFD1PqAYD6F1QMn3
transaction
254b68b0b305c37c0e77f7d78c03cdafed3a4947f74bfa5995c36f0739e92eab
confirmations
461612
spent
true